Mn13 Wear Resistant Manganese Steel Plate
Mn13 High Manganese Wear Resistant Steel, also known as Hadfield Steel, is a high manganese austenitic alloy with excellent work NMening properties under heavy impact or pressure.
Key Features
Work Hardening: Under high stress or impact, the surface NMness increases rapidly from 200 HBW to >500 HBW, forming a wear resistant layer while maintaining core toughness.
Self-Renewing Wear Resistance: As the surface layer wears, continuous NMening occurs, ensuring long-term durability.
Ductility and Machinability: Good weldability and formability are maintained in the pre-NMened state.
Mn13 wear-resistant steel plates are widely used in high-impact environments:
Mining and construction: crusher liners, buckets and conveying systems.
Railways: turnout plates, turnout components.
Energy and heavy machinery: ball mill liners, crusher jaws.
Advanced applications: bulletproof vehicles, maglev train components.
FAQ
Q: Does Mn13 require post-manufacturing heat treatment?
A: No, it is usually used in the water-quenched (solution treated) condition.
Q: Is Mn13 corrosion-resistant?
A: No. Coatings (e.g. galvanizing) are recommended for corrosive environments.
Q: Can Mn13 replace SM490 steel?
A: No. SM490 is a structural steel with unique composition and impact toughness requirements.
